I completed my experienced worker nvq3 which was long overdue. I have been working for years and never bothered with the nvq3, but suddenly niceic and napit etc want it. I had a deadline to pass this nvq3 and was able to do it in about 6 months. Xs were very helpful to get me seen by assesors on site asap and help to push the course along.

The only thing holding me back was a bit of slowdown with work to get the right range of work documented. But all registered with the niceic now and now going for gold card. Highly reccomended.
